For those of you that are not regular apron wearers, I would like to suggest you give them a try. I can’t explain what it is about wearing an apron that is so empowering. Maybe it is the “official” feeling wearing an apron creates. It doesn’t matter if I’m baking a cake from scratch or just putting spoonfuls of refrigerated cookie dough into the oven. Wearing an apron makes it feel like I’m really good at it. Then again, maybe I love wearing aprons because of the connection I feel to the other women, past and present, in my family. Many pictures I still have of my Grandma are of her wearing aprons. Some are of the holiday baking, and some are just everyday breakfast moments captured. I can’t help but see the resemblance when I see a reflection of myself wearing an apron. Even if I’m not quite the bubbly, goofy, beautiful, and ever so skilled cook that I remember of my grandma, I feel a little more like her when I have an apron on. Or, maybe it’s simply the feeling of relief when bacon grease splatters and I realize that my clothes are protected. No need to run out of the kitchen ripping off my clothes to immediately treat a stain and find something else to wear. Nope, just untie the apron once I’m finished cooking and throw it in the washer or simply hang it back on its hook. That’s what it is for. The other feelings are just an added bonus. &l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/925795057863164395-3442647989054250803?l=mrshippie.blogspot.com'/&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://mrshippie.blogspot.com/feeds/3442647989054250803/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='https://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=925795057863164395&amp;postID=3442647989054250803' title='1 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/925795057863164395/posts/default/3442647989054250803'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/925795057863164395/posts/default/3442647989054250803'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://mrshippie.blogspot.com/2007/12/day-1.html' title='Day 1'/><author><name>Mrs. Hippie</name><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:extendedProperty xmlns:gd='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005' name='OpenSocialUserId' value='14752976318614362549'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_mwKn_NMNHHI/R1RWASop-wI/AAAAAAAAAAY/tGe_4169bG8/s72-c/Half+Aprons+004.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total xmlns:thr='http://purl.org/syndication/thread/1.0'>1</thr:total></entry></feed>
